I have been reading a few forums (uk ones). Apparently the shop on Via Farini do not stock tickets, they order them in instead. It takes one day from going into the shop and buying tickets to the tickets actually being available. This means (as I'm flying in on the day ofnthe game) I have no option but to buy online.
Peruzzi, does this sound right to you? Have you had to return to the shop the day after ordering, to collect tickets?

just one more question Peruzzi 

The idenity card 'Tessera' I have been reading about...do I need to register to obtain one of these before buying tickets? Do I need one at all?

No you only need one for buying tickets to away games or season tickets.
Single tickets to home games, youre fine with just your passport as ID.

Not even sure if non-Italian citizens can have them? If anyone knows this, id like to know, cos I want one!

Ticket usually only go on sale the week before the game for Serie A fixtures, although I dont know if thats different online.

As for seats thats just personal preference, I dont think anywhere has bad seats in Olimpico. I usually go in Tevere Laterale, close to Nord.

Today I recieved the below message from the Lazio website in reply to an email I sent last week,

About the game LAZIO at the Olimpic Stadium, you can book tickets on internet (www.sslazio.it under BIGLIETTERIA & Stadio) about two to one week before the match  (check on our web site the date of saling) and pay with credit card and collect them at the Olimpic Stadium three hours before the match at the "Box 3  in Piazzale De Bosis" (1).
Otherwise you can directly contact by phone the Lis Ticket call center: 0039-0260060900. At the same for the above you can collect them at the Olimpic Stadium three hours before the match at the "Box 3 Accrediti in Piazzale De Bosis".
If you want, you can buy ticket the day of the macth in LAZIO STYLE 1900 (2), Via G. Calderini 66c, near the Olimpic Stadium. Or, if you arrived in Rome same days before the match, you can see the map of the box-offices on www.sslazio.it under BIGLIETTERIA.

With best regards.


It has a map of both the Piazzale De Bosis and also the shop at Via G. Calderini. Really helpful reply.
